TL;DR

In 2026, the leading AI smartwatches are the Apple Watch Series 11, Samsung Galaxy Watch 8, and Garmin vívoactive 5, offering top fitness tracking and connectivity. Choice depends on phone ecosystem, battery needs, and desired features.

In 2026, the Apple Watch Series 11 remains the top overall choice for iPhone users, offering a balanced combination of health tracking, app support, and design polish. Meanwhile, Samsung Galaxy Watch 8 is the best option for Android users, and Garmin vívoactive 5 leads in battery life. Shopping for smartwatches in 2026 primarily hinges on ecosystem compatibility, with Apple and Samsung dominating their respective platforms. For a detailed overview, see the original analysis. The Apple Watch Series 11 offers comprehensive health sensors, a refined user interface, and seamless iPhone integration, making it the top pick for Apple users. The Samsung Galaxy Watch 8 provides similar features for Android users, with some functions optimized for Samsung phones, according to product reviews.

The Garmin vívoactive 5 excels in battery life, lasting up to 11 days on a single charge, which appeals to users prioritizing long-term usage without frequent charging. The Apple Watch SE 3 offers a compelling value, delivering most of the Series 11’s features at roughly 40% less cost, making it suitable for budget-conscious buyers. The more premium models, like the Apple Watch Ultra 3, are targeted at serious athletes and tech enthusiasts, with advanced sensors and durable builds, though at a higher price point.

Unresolved Questions About Long-Term Software Support and Sensor Accuracy

While current reviews confirm the performance of the top models, it is still unclear how software updates will affect long-term usability, especially for budget models. Sensor accuracy, particularly for health metrics, varies across brands, and future firmware updates may improve or diminish current performance. Additionally, some features are still limited to specific ecosystems, which could change as manufacturers expand compatibility.

Key Questions

Which smartwatch offers the best battery life in 2026?

The Garmin vívoactive 5 leads in battery life, lasting up to 11 days per charge, making it ideal for users who dislike frequent charging.

Are premium smartwatches worth the higher price?

For users seeking accurate health sensors, durable build quality, and advanced features like GPS and cellular independence, premium models such as the Apple Watch Series 11 and Ultra 3 justify their cost. Casual users may find value in more affordable options like the Apple Watch SE 3.

Can I switch between ecosystems easily?

Switching ecosystems is generally difficult; Apple Watches only work with iPhones, while Samsung and other Android-compatible watches have limited features on non-Samsung devices. Compatibility and feature availability depend heavily on the device ecosystem.

Will software updates improve budget smartwatch accuracy?

It is uncertain; while updates may enhance sensor performance, budget models typically have less sophisticated hardware, which limits potential improvements over their lifespan.
